“The Buffalo Spot - Los Cerritos Center” is the company that has come to be known as not only the place where you will be served the best wings, ribs, or our WORLD FAMOUS BUFFALO FRIES; but is the family friendly “SPOT” where unlike any other wing places, we pride ourselves in not only serving you the best quality food, but also in treating you, your family, or friends, with the most love or respect that any human being deserves.